Hi everyone.

Recently I coded Toledo Atomchess 6502, a basic chess game with graphical board for Atari VCS/2600.

All the source code is available at https://github.com/nanochess/Atomchess-6502

I've wrote with it in mind for the Hackaday 1K challenge where I've entered it.

The hardest part was to fit the graphical chessboard as the Atari doesn't provide any support routines and the TIA is very primitive. It works very well for its size.

I've made a video showing it in action https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=_Du4krvIl7o

Ouch! I wonder how hard it is to put that video through a slow persistence-of-vision filter? I had a quick play with vlc and ffmpeg but got nowhere.

Have you seen the original Computer Chess which uses a venetian blinds effect to make the game pieces from the player graphics?
http://www.atariprotos.com/2600/softwar ... rchess.htm
